Illinois·Topic GOVERNMENT·Ch. 20 EXECUTIVE BRANCH·Act 20 ILCS 605/ Civil Administrative Code of Illinois. (Department of Commerce and Economic Opportunity Law)
(was 20 ILCS 605/46.19e) Sec. 605-615. Assistance with exports. The Department shall have the following duties and responsibilities in regard to the Civil Administrative Code of Illinois:
(1)To establish or cosponsor mentoring conferences, utilizing experienced manufacturing exporters, to explain and provide information to prospective export manufacturers and businesses concerning the process of exporting to both domestic and international opportunities.
(2)To provide technical assistance to prospective export manufacturers and businesses seeking to establish domestic and international export opportunities.
(3)To coordinate with the Department's Small Business Development Centers to link buyers with prospective export manufacturers and businesses.
